dashboards for individuals into a single report

Hello everyone,

 

Problem Statement:- I'm having 20 clients data. And the data model/schema is same for all the 20 client reports only the data values are different now it is not feasible to make 20 client reports and publish them one at a time by client Id. What I want is that I want to combine all the 20 reports and provide RLS security on a filter named CLIENTS e.g. C0001, B0002, A0004, J0009, etc. And according to the roles applied on RLS, will give access to the mail I'd I assigned. Note- start date & end date different for all the 20 reports and daily refresh is ON. Data source- SQL server import mode.

 

How can I combine all the 20 reports of the different clients into 1 report and assign RLS too??

Hi @Anonymous ,

If I understand your scenario correctly that you have 20 pbix for 20 clients?

Are the 20 clients data from one data source?

If so, you could get data from the data source and create the report, then you could set Roles in Power BI Desktop.

Please refer to this blog how to create the dynamic RLS in Power BI Desktop.

If not, you could import the multiple data sources in the one pbix and then create the report.
